### Runbook: Report export timezone mismatches (Glimmerfield)

If a customer reports that exported totals differ from the dashboard, check whether their report schedule predates the March cutover — older schedules still render in server-local time rather than the account timezone. Re-saving the schedule fixes it. Before escalating, confirm the export worker is running with the expected timezone settings shown below.

config for kadup-kajog:
[raldor]
host = raldor.tolvaqworks.internal
user = raldor_svc
database = raldor_prod

Subject: Liftsim cut-over done

Team,

The Verticore elevator-dispatch simulator moved to the new Brasshollow cluster last night. Old endpoints are dead as of 06:00. Scenario replays, car-assignment logs, and the peak-traffic harness all verified. One hiccup with the lobby-queue seed data, fixed before handoff. Nothing else outstanding. New contractors: point your local runner at the values pasted below.

deployment values, yafog-tahop:
ZOROK_PIN=9451
ZOROK_TENANT=novael
ZOROK_METRICS_HOST=metrics.zorok.crelvocloud.corp
ZOROK_SEAL=seal_8d0b0d39
ZOROK_STANDBY_TEAM=jorir

Welcome to the Gallerywhisper team! This is the audio-guide app used by the Thornfield Museum network, and you're inheriting a codebase with some personality. The tour engine syncs exhibit audio via room beacons, and offline mode caches everything on first launch, so don't break the preload path or visitors in the basement galleries get silence. Builds go out Tuesdays; the content team owns the narration files, we own playback. Architecture notes, quirks, and the release checklist are all collected here.

operations page: https://jira.qorvelsys.internal/browse/pages/browse/pages